A Problem Has Occurred in the Network Board

Content Id: 8100076100


Issue

A problem has occurred in the network board.

Cause and solution

The network board is not connected properly.

See "Chapter 9 Installing the Optional Accessories" in User's Guide in the CD-ROM supplied with the printer and make sure that the network board is connected to the printer properly.

Caution

If the ERR indicator on the network board is on or blinking, or if all the indicators on the network board are off, see "Chapter 4 Troubleshooting" in Network Guide in the CD-ROM supplied with the printer and solve the problem.

Cause and solution

The network board is set to the unicast communication mode.

Specify the normal mode (the broadcast communication mode). For more details, see [Using the Unicast Communication Mode] or ask your network administrator.
